Top Law News Delhi Hight Court asks IOA to maintain ‘status quo’ in hockey September 26, 2012 by Legal India Admin | Leave a Comment The Delhi High Court Tuesday asked the Indian Olympic Association (IOA) to maintain “status quo” over the official hockey body in the country. Top Law News Court reserves order on plea against Hockey India ‘threats’ December 8, 2011 by Legal India Admin | Leave a Comment The Delhi High Court on Wednesday reserved its order on a plea alleging that Hockey India (HI) was threatening players to prevent them from taking part in the World Series Hockey (WSH) tournament.
